MICHELE NORRIS, host:

Finally, a decision on a case known as Brand X. It hasn't gotten much media attention, but consumer advocates say the decision could have an enormous impact. They say it will mean higher prices for high-speed Internet service, and they warn that consumers may not have the same degree of open access to the Internet. The cable companies involved in the case say exactly the opposite. NPR's Laura Sydell reports.
